To craft bows in OSRS, players need to gather specific materials based on the type of bow they wish to create. The primary materials required are logs and string. Different types of logs correspond to different bow types, from basic shortbows to powerful longbows.
1. *Logs: The type of log you use significantly impacts the bow’s quality and level requirements. Common logs used for bow making include:
- Normal Logs: Used to create a Shortbow and Longbow (level 1).
- Willow Logs: Used for making Willow Shortbows and Longbows (level 30).
- Maple Logs: Used for Maple Shortbows and Longbows (level 45).
- Yew Logs: Used for Yew Shortbows and Longbows (level 60).
- Magic Logs: Used for Magic Shortbows and Longbows (level 75).
Players can chop down trees corresponding to their desired logs using the Woodcutting skill. Higher-level trees yield more advanced logs but require greater Woodcutting levels to chop.
2. Bow Strings: To string a bow, players need bow strings, which are crafted from flax. Flax can be grown from seeds or purchased from other players. Once harvested, players can spin flax into bow strings using a spinning wheel, which is found in several locations throughout Gielinor.
3. Additional Tools*: While the primary materials required for bow making are logs and string, players may also benefit from having a knife. A knife is used to fletch the logs into bow forms. It is a simple tool that can be obtained from various locations or purchased from general stores.
